2. FinTech & B2B Cross-Border Real-Time Payment Infrastructure
Cross-border digital settlement networks are experiencing record volume growth. Driven by global supply chain diversification and ISO 20022 messaging adoption, institutional payment corridors are moving away from legacy correspondent banking networks toward instant, zero-latency settlement protocol layers.
Commercial banks and payment processors deploying automated liquidity corridors have reduced cross-border transaction costs by up to 38%. Our quantitative valuation model projects the global B2B cross-border payment market to expand at a 24.5% CAGR through 2035, driven by surging corporate trade in Southeast Asia, North America, and Europe.
3. Generative AI in Oncology Drug Discovery & Biomarker Diagnostics
In healthcare and biotechnology, transformer neural networks are fundamentally rewriting the economics of pharmaceutical R&D. Historically, identifying a viable small-molecule inhibitor required over four years of preclinical wet-lab testing at a cost exceeding $400 Million USD.
Generative AI molecular docking and protein folding models have compressed preclinical candidate selection from 48 months to under 8 months. Multinational pharmaceutical leaders including Pfizer, Roche, and AstraZeneca have committed cumulative investments exceeding $12.5 Billion into computational oncology startups to secure exclusive pipeline licensing rights.
4. Green Hydrogen & Industrial Electrolyzer Capacity Expansion
The global push for net-zero carbon neutrality has accelerated sovereign capital deployment into green hydrogen infrastructure. Electrolyzer manufacturing capacity—spanning Proton Exchange Membrane (PEM) and Alkaline systems—is ramping dramatically across Europe, North America, and the Middle East.
Sovereign subsidies such as the US Inflation Reduction Act tax credits and EU Renewable Energy Directives are driving levelized cost of hydrogen (LCOH) projections toward parity with fossil fuels by 2032. Our energy valuation models project green hydrogen electrolyzer capacity to compound at 32.0% CAGR.
